Transaction 4aba59cdf3802d7b87f9184b992f28af7ae31e11ebec73db313ae9f0264eb63b

1 Input
2 Outputs
  • 4aba59cdf3802d7b87f9184b992f28af7ae31e11ebec73db313ae9f0264eb63b:0
  • value  4277497036
    address  38VYSVYhS5MCYm9qKhtJGSXDKyD5f5sd9d
  • 4aba59cdf3802d7b87f9184b992f28af7ae31e11ebec73db313ae9f0264eb63b:1
  • value  11564000
    address  1EWtpnUbHJrEsPfzyCrskK8vEAzF3qfiqU